i've made a small web interface for it.

screenshot: https://www.dropbox.com/s/od0ac7djvvdyrps/gekkoweb.png
source: https://www.dropbox.com/s/54y2crazfnyghnd/gekko.zip

i am not familiar with npm or node. so you have to install a few dependencies by hand (eg npm install express).

there are currently some drawbacks:
 - portfolio is only updated after a successfull buy or sell
 - web interface does work as soon as a the first advice is made.
 - only ema does work as the web if does show some internal data from it

i use it in "advanced mode" using data from mtgox and trading on mtgox and btce (but only with small amounts)

i did not test it with other configurations, so use it at your own risk (i am not responsiple for any losses etc).

as this is a pure personal project i dont think i'll make other extensions, but i am always open for suggestions
